首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在应用退出时弹出确认提示

需求 在应用退出时(点击右上角的关闭按钮)弹出一个确认按钮可以说是一个最常见的操作了,例如记事本的“你是否保存”: ? 但这个功能在UWP上居然有点小复杂。这篇文章将解释如何实现这个功能。 2....弹出确认提示 CloseRequested事件包含一个名为SystemNavigationCloseRequestedPreviewEventArgs的EventArgs(名字真是超级长),它包含一个...Capabilities> 这样,在本地运行的时候,应用终于可以弹出确认提示了...这样,所有工作都做了,确认提示功能终于完成了。 5. 然而还有BUG ?...弹是不可能弹的,只能装死了。 所以这时候程序就完全没有反应。当应用重新回到前台运行,确认才会弹出来。不过只是个小小的bug,我们可以选择原谅它: ? 6.

3.9K10
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    如何在调用WCF服务之前弹出一个确认对话

    昨天有人在微博上问我如下一个问题: 老蒋,客户端调用wcf的一个接口函数时,有没有什么办法可以先弹出一个确认确认执行调用。...因为这个接口函数再很多地方都执行了调用,所以我想在某个入口进行统一地弹出一个确认... ?...在每次调用服务之前都会弹出一个确认对话,真正的服务调用只有在用户确认之后方能进行。...我们在BeginDisplayInitializationUI方法中弹出一个确认对话,并将用户的确认选择封装到一个简单的AsyncResult对象中返回。...4: { 5: [OperationContract] 6: double Add(double x, double y); 7: } 那么在进行服务调用的时候,确认对话会自动弹出

    1.3K90

    弹出层之1:JQuery.Boxy (二)

    在《弹出层之1:JQuery.Boxy (一)》中讲到了JQuery.Boxy的基本用法,本次讲下手动创建实例,new一个boxy对象是很容易的,传递一些参数对象就能满足不同的需求了。...resize(w,h,after) 重新调整对话的高宽到[w,h],完成执行回调函数,回调函数将接受Boxy实例作为参数。可链接。...tween(w,h,after) 动画补间对话高宽到[w,h],完成执行回调函数,回调函数将接受Boxy实例作为参数。可链接。...isVisible() 如果当前对话可见,则返回true,否则返回false。 show() 显示对话,可链接。 hide(after) 隐藏对话,after为可选回调函数,完成执行。...toggle() 触发对话的显隐属性。可链接。 hideAndUnload(after) 在隐藏立即执行卸载。在卸载之前执行after回调函数。可链接。

    4K20

    Selenium4+Python3系列(七) - Iframe、Select控件、交互式弹出执行JS、Cookie操作

    三、交互操作弹出的处理 1、弹出分类: 弹出分为两种,一种基于原生JavaScript写出来的弹窗,另一种是自定义封装好的样式的弹出,即原生JavaScript写出来的弹窗,另一种弹窗用click...JavaScript写出来的弹窗又分为三种: alert img_4.png confirm img_5.png prompt img_6.png 2、弹窗处理常用方法: alert/confirm/prompt弹出操作主要方法有...: driver.switch_to.alert:切换到alert弹出框上 alert.text:获取文本值 accept() :点击"确认" dismiss():点击"取消"或者关闭对话 send_keys...) alert.accept() sleep(2) print(alert.text) 四、执行Js操作 在做web自动化时,有些情况selenium的api无法完成,需要通过第三方手段比如js来完成实现...示例代码如下: # 执行js语句 driver.execute_script("alert('hellow,world!')")

    8.7K10

    layer弹出层详解

    前言:学习layer弹出,之前项目是用bootstrap模态,后来改用layer弹出,在文章的后面,我会分享项目的一些代码(我自己写的)。...layer如何获取父界面的元素,比如我点击新增按钮,在layer编辑提交,是如何关闭当前layer,额,关闭layer很简单,但是如何关闭根据父界面的form表单向后台发起Ajax请求,,刷新信息...; btn – 按钮 类型:String/Array,默认:’确认’ 信息模式时,btn默认是一个确认按钮,其它层类型则默认不显示,加载层和tips层则无效。...如: View Code success – 层弹出的成功回调方法 类型:Function,默认:null 当你需要在层创建完毕时即执行一些语句,可以通过该回调。...封装好的Layer弹出与关闭layer弹出的方法(代码周一给出, 现在手头没有代码): 链接参考:https://www.cnblogs.com/0zcl/p/7341984.html 发布者:

    5.1K20

    弹出层之1:JQuery.Boxy (一)

    Boxy是一个基于JQuery弹出层插件,它有相对漂亮的外观,功能齐全,支持iframe,支持模式窗口但相对于同样的弹出层插件BlockUI它明显笨重,但使用不那么方便。...js文件:jquery.boxy.js;1个css文件;还有4个图片用于构成弹出层的4个圆角。...      我是超链接弹出来的 a标签中的 title如果不设置,弹出将没有标题且不能拖动;href后面的锚记...3.3、提交时以确认形式弹出         $(function() {             $(".boxy").boxy();...,该属性为弹出的显示信息,默认为:“请确认:” 3、每个匹配锚title属性将被用来作为其相应的对话的标题 4、message的内容的display属性都将设置为block(显示为块) 下载本文示例

    2.9K10

    jquery - 页面弹 - 阻止事件冒泡示例

    需求 编写一个简单的页面弹的示例,功能要求如下: 一个点击按钮,点击可以弹出一个弹固定出现在页面的中间位置 需要写一个背景mask,用于遮掩背景,设置透明度0.3 点击弹外的位置,弹就可以消失不见...阻止.pop弹的click()事件,直接return false,就可以避免点击弹的时候执行$(document).click()里面的fadeOut()事件 ?...点击.pop以外的$(document)部分并不会至上而下得触发到.pop的click()方法,从而直接执行$(document)内的fadeOut,并没有弹出.pop的alert()。 ?...在这个验证的过程中,更加确认了刚才在.pop使用return false;的确是用来阻止click()的冒泡至$(document)的。...点击#close,正常执行fadeOut(),并且在.pop处已经截断了事件冒泡,所以在#close的 click()最后不用写return false;。

    3.3K10
    领券